I'd prefer to not add more jack stuff until jack2 has been released. jack1 probably won't get a sndio backend, but I will make one for jack2. it may be a while until jack2 is official, but from what I've read, it's better designed, more portable and more reliable. it is not designed by the orginal jack developers, but by someone who actually cares about !linux ... and was the person who imported the audio(4) backend into jack1. -- jake...@sdf.lonestar.org SDF Public Access UNIX System - http://sdf.lonestar.org
